Apollo/Sunshine into Moonlight, resolution changing?

I've tried both Sunshine and Apollo and I'm not sure how to go with this, can anyone help?

I want to connect to my desktop PC upstairs (1920x1080) and use that for gaming remotely. However sometimes I play on the Steamdeck undocked, so it's at 1280x800 16:10, sometimes I dock it to a TV that plays at 1920x1080 16:9.

I can only seem to see a way to "fix" it to one resolution, even with the magical display driver thingy that Apollo installs.

My understanding was that the steamdeck detects what display it's connected to and that info goes to the remote PC that should adjust it's resolution accordingly.

I guess what I need is a relatively user friendly way to get the Apollo or Sunshine client on the PC to understand that if I'm undocked it needs to sort itself into a different resolution/aspect ratio than if it's docked.

Is this an issue anyone has solved? I've searched and have seen a few solutions but I'm not entirely sure it's the same problem I'm having and none of them have worked properly anyway.

To update this, it seems the remote pc will switch resolutions but I have to go into the Moonlight settings on the SteamDeck every time and select the new resolution then scale the bitrate up because it annoyingly lowers the slider each time. Or I can connect to the remote PC and use a usb keyboard to manually change the resolution that way.

Either way something isn't communicating with something else.

u/Prytos 4d ago

Vibepollo and Apollo works fine, make sure you are using virtual display. When it's enabled disable your pc monitor in windows settings. After this every device will use his own resolution after connect.
